Synthesis and evaluation of nitroheterocyclic aromatic adamantane amides with trypanocidal activity. Part II

Abstract:

New nitroheterocyclic adamantane amides display promising trypanocidal activity. The spacer length between the adamantylphenyl backbone and the nitroheterocyclic ring plays a crucial role in potency.
